[comp.sys.tandy] Uprating The Model 4

I've started thinking recently as to what features and improvements I'd
like to see in an uprated Model 4.  Clearly this is something of a pipe-
dream, since Tandy seems happy to let the 4 die.  However, one never knows
what will happen when a bunch of dedicated hardware hackers get together,
so here goes...

Needless to say, we start with a Z-280 CPU.  The HD64180 is nice, but the
Zilog chip is Clearly Superior.  640x480 COLOR graphics, with some insane
number of possible colors and a BIG palette (say, 1,024 colors, just to
irk the Mac II lovers).  This has the advantage of being able to drop back
to 640x240 mode to run existing Hi-Res applications and games, etc.  A serial
keyboard, like the ones on Amiga and Mac.  Since the 4 took the first step
away from memory-mapping the keyboard, why not go all the way andonly map
the keyboard for the Model 3 mode??  This kind of keyboard is much more
efficient and easier to deal with software-wise.  At least 1MB of RAM stand-
ard, with space on the motherboard for more, all of which conforms to the
@BANK standard.  SCSI port.  More than 1 serial port.  Built in joystick
and mouse connectors that agree with current 3rd party standard add-ons.
SLOTS!!  Or some other more rational expansion system than 1 lousy card
edge; the new expansion system should also provide a more complete set
of CPU signals than the current one does.

Well, that's not too coherent, but hits most of the high points, I think.
